👤 The Conversion of Paul
Saul, persecutor of Christians, encountered the risen Jesus, was blinded, and became Paul—the greatest missionary of the church. He started churches, wrote two-thirds of the New Testament, and testified to seeing the risen Lord.
👥 Eyewitness Testimony
Paul records in 1 Corinthians 15:3–6 that Jesus appeared to more than 500 people at once, many still alive when Paul wrote—inviting skeptics to verify the claim. Historians date this creed within 2 years of Jesus’ death, proving the resurrection was proclaimed immediately, not invented centuries later.

🏛️ Non-Christian Sources
Even hostile or secular sources confirm key facts.
💠 Tacitus, Pliny the Younger, and Lucian wrote of Jesus and His followers.
💠 Josephus recorded that Jesus was crucified under Pilate and appeared alive on the third day.
💠 The Jewish Talmud, though hostile, says Jesus was a Sorcerer.
